Transaction 88632ffdff49ca387dd837c252ed4a9c21b18ddc54d385a20d99848c0e61d6dc
1 Input
1 Output
-
88632ffdff49ca387dd837c252ed4a9c21b18ddc54d385a20d99848c0e61d6dc:0
- value
- 151476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c94f05e47d94aa9a02063145681f2f6018e202b OP_EQUAL
- address
- 3QiYdLu7emturZkdMiCmUVMr4zjmrhwWSK